Under normal circumstances, the fund will invest at least 80 percent of its net assets in equity securities issued by U.S. companies and other instruments with economic characteristics similar to equity securities issued by U.S. companies. Equity securities include common stock, preferred stock and securities or other instruments whose price is linked to the value of common or preferred stock. More on Six Circles Unconstrained
